There seems to be a correlation between positive cases and Greek life on campuses. Many people on social media such as Tik Tok have pointed out this theme, and everyone who is not part of it seems to be annoyed by it. I am not in Greek life, so I only have an outside view but am basing this blog off of what I have heard and seen. Included in this blog is a screenshot from The University of Kentucky President explaining Phase 2 of testing only people in greek life because they contained a higher percentage of positive COVID19 cases. There has been a lack of social distancing with people belonging to greek life at the University of Kentucky, especially over the past couple of weeks as they try to recruit others to join. Most of the people in greek life, I believe since a large percentage of people in greek life have had COVID19 they think they're safe from getting it again. I am not sure if these gatherings will end once they have finished recruiting, but from an outside view, it is interesting to see people believe the rules do not apply to them, which I believe is due to this group mentality. Sororities and Fraternities consist of a large group, and so this creates a crowd behavior that normalizes behaviors an individual would likely restrain from. For example, when they participate in a party for their sorority or fraternity, it's the whole group that mostly gets punished. Meanwhile, other parties that are not associated with a group blame the individual instead of an entire group. It is also acceptable in these groups to have parties further normalizing this behavior because their fellow members are participating in the same actions. I believe this gives them a sense of anonymity and increases the likelihood of participating in large gatherings. Greek life can be an excellent way to get involved on campus but fosters some behaviors that do not coincide with being a responsible adult.
